Edit
Tod Oly Knows: Rancor I (Music Video 2018) Poster

(2018 Music Video)

Full Cast & Crew

Directed by 

Todd Larson

Produced by 

Griffey Larson ... executive producer
Todd Larson ... associate producer
Mr. Toad ... producer

Music Department 

Mackenzie Olson ... performer
Steve Olson ... soundtrack

See also

Release Dates | Official Sites | Company Credits | Filming & Production | Technical Specs

Contribute to This Page


Recently Viewed